Article Capturing and Re-Using Rendition Styles for Non-Photorealistic Rendering

Author(s): Jörg Hamel, Thomas Strothotte.
Article: Computer Graphics Forum, Vol. 18, No. 3, 1999.
[BibTeX] Find this paper on Google

Abstract:
Rendering high-quality non-photorealistic images of a given geometric model is often associated with a considerable amount of effort on the part of a user to fine-tune the rendition. In this paper we introduce a method and tools for re-using the user’s effort invested in one model for the rendering of other models. Our method uses templates to describe rendition styles. The paper gives a number of examples of the successful transfer of styles from one model to another.
